aarch64: fix entry into debug state 51/3751/5
authorMatthias Welwarsky <matthias.welwarsky@sysgo.com>
Fri, 16 Sep 2016 09:34:03 +0000 (11:34 +0200)
committerMatthias Welwarsky <matthias.welwarsky@sysgo.com>
Fri, 10 Feb 2017 13:01:38 +0000 (14:01 +0100)
- armv8 EDSCR has no ITR_EN bit, ITR is always enabled. Writes to this
  bit are ignored but we should not do them anyway
- use dpmv8 function to report the reason for debug entry
- WFAR is a 64bit register
